Tredway, a real estate developer of affordable and mixed housing, recently purchased Ocean Park in Far Rockaway. This purchase may be of interest to those in nearby Valley Stream.
Part of the team that worked on the purchase agreement was founding partner of Ariel Property Advisors, Victor Sozio. He said that this will mean a new chapter for property, which was built in 1971, and it will also see some significant capital improvements.
The city’s Department of Housing Preservation and Development entered an agreement with Tredway to keep 179 units affordable for people earning 80% of the median income in the area and 423 units at 60% to prevent significant rent increases in the coming years. City Harvest will also be providing expanded monthly food distributions, and Rising Tides Effect, a non-profit organization, will be offering water safety and swimming programming.

Founder and CEO of Tredway, Will Blodgett, expressed his excitement about taking on the stewardship of Ocean Park and undertaking a preservation effort that will improve the affordability of the property, while also carrying out expanded social services, improvements in energy efficiency, and critical capital repairs.
Blodgett added that a collaboration of city, state, and federal housing officials, as well as the elected representatives in the area and the residents of the complex, made this purchase and preservation possible.
